How they compare
Brazil currently reports 149,420 Tonnes of CO2-equivalent against 43,162 Tonnes of CO2-equivalent in Indonesia, a difference of 106,258 Tonnes of CO2-equivalent.
That makes Brazil's figure about 3.5 times Indonesia's.
Across all 23 years both countries report, Brazil has been ahead every year.
Brazil ranks 1st and Indonesia ranks 3rd of 40 countries.
Brazil has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Brazil | Indonesia |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 105,009 Tonnes of CO2-equivalent | 30,922 Tonnes of CO2-equivalent | 74,087 Tonnes of CO2-equivalent | Brazil |
| 2010s | 131,031 Tonnes of CO2-equivalent | 38,593 Tonnes of CO2-equivalent | 92,438 Tonnes of CO2-equivalent | Brazil |
| 2020s | 146,936 Tonnes of CO2-equivalent | 43,685 Tonnes of CO2-equivalent | 103,252 Tonnes of CO2-equivalent | Brazil |
Averages of every year both report within each decade.
